Picking the Right Wall Surface



Selecting the optimal wall surface to function as an accent in a room calls for careful consideration of elements such as lighting, room design, and prime focus. When determining the ideal wall surface for an accent, it is important to evaluate the all-natural and fabricated lights in the room. A well-lit wall can improve the accent color, while a darker area might refrain it justice.



Furthermore, the format of the room plays a considerable role. Choosing a wall that normally attracts the eye can develop a harmonious flow in the room. In addition, comprehending the area's objective is essential in choosing the appropriate wall for an accent. In living spaces, for instance, the wall surface behind the primary seating area is commonly picked to create a focal point. Conversely, in rooms, the wall behind the bed is a preferred option for an accent, including deepness and aesthetic interest to the area.

Selecting the Perfect Color



When thinking about the optimal shade for an accent wall surface, it is necessary to take into consideration the existing color combination of the room and the preferred setting. The color you pick must enhance the total theme of the room while including visual rate of interest.

One technique is to pick a color that is currently present in the area, probably in a furniture or an art piece, to produce a natural appearance. Conversely, you can go with a contrasting shade to make a bold declaration and develop a focal point in the room.

Dark colors can make an area really feel smaller sized, while light shades can produce a sense of visibility.

Sample the picked color on the wall surface and observe exactly how it changes throughout the day with varying light conditions. Remember, the ideal shade is one that not only looks good on its own but also improves the general aesthetic of the room.

Harmonizing Patterns and Structures



To accomplish a harmonious appearance when integrating accent wall surfaces, it is vital to meticulously balance the use of patterns and structures within the area. When choosing patterns for an accent wall surface, consider the existing patterns in the area. If the space already has strong patterns in furnishings or decor, opt for a much more refined pattern on the accent wall surface to prevent overwhelming the room.

Alternatively, if the room is primarily single or simple, a vibrant pattern on the accent wall surface can include passion and depth to the room.

Structures play a vital role in developing an aesthetically enticing room as well. Blending various structures adds dimension and richness to the area. As an example, combining a streamlined, shiny accent wall surface with a plush, distinctive rug can create a dynamic contrast.

It is necessary to strike a balance between different textures to stop the area from feeling as well busy or disjointed.
